What a New AC System Actually Costs in LA Right Now
For a typical single-family home in the Valley or Los Feliz — say 1,600 to 2,200 square feet, existing ductwork in decent shape, straightforward attic or side-yard condenser placement — a full split-system AC replacement runs about $7,500 to $12,500 installed in 2026. That's for a 2 to 3.5 ton system, which covers the vast majority of homes we work on from North Hollywood down through Toluca Lake and out to Van Nuys.
Go smaller and simpler (a straight 14.3 SEER2 single-stage system with a compatible coil and no ductwork work) and you can land closer to $6,800 to $8,500. Go bigger, variable-speed, or add in duct replacement, electrical panel work, or a difficult attic pull, and $16,000 to $22,000+ is not unusual. We know that's a frustrating answer if you wanted one number, but anyone who quotes you a single flat price without stepping into your attic or crawling the ductwork first is guessing.
The Real Cost Breakdown: Equipment, Labor, Ductwork, Permits
Equipment
The condenser and coil are usually 40-55% of the total job cost. A baseline 14.3 SEER2 single-stage Trane or Carrier system for a 2,000 sq ft home runs $3,200-$4,800 in equipment cost alone before labor. Step up to a two-stage 16-17 SEER2 system and you're at $4,800-$6,500 in equipment. Full variable-speed systems like the Trane XV20i or XV18 — the ones that actually modulate output instead of slamming on and off — push equipment cost to $7,500-$10,000+ depending on tonnage.
Labor
Labor for a straightforward swap-out (same location, same electrical, same ductwork) runs $2,500-$4,000 for a licensed crew doing it right — proper brazing with nitrogen purge, vacuum to 500 microns, correct refrigerant charge by weight and superheat/subcooling, not just "let's see what the gauges say." Cutting corners here is exactly how you end up with a new system failing in three years instead of fifteen.
Ductwork
This is the line item that blows up budgets in older LA housing stock. Homes built before the 1970s in North Hollywood, Studio City, and parts of Burbank-adjacent neighborhoods often have undersized, crushed, or asbestos-wrapped ductwork that was never sized for modern equipment. Partial duct replacement adds $2,000-$4,500. Full duct system replacement, which we recommend more often than homeowners expect, adds $4,500-$9,000.
Permits and testing
A mechanical permit through LADBS for AC replacement typically runs $250-$450 depending on valuation. If your ductwork is in the attic (most of LA is), California's Title 24 energy code requires duct leakage testing by a certified HERS rater before final inspection — that's another $350-$600. Skipping this isn't a shortcut; it's how homeowners end up with an unpermitted system that becomes a real problem at resale.
Why 2026 Pricing Looks Different Than It Did in 2022
Three things changed the math, and none of them are marketing spin.
First, the refrigerant transition. As of 2025, new residential AC equipment sold in the U.S. moved off R-410A and onto R-454B under the EPA's AIM Act phasedown. R-454B is mildly flammable (classified A2L), which means new equipment has different safety listings, different line set and component requirements, and manufacturers are still working through supply and pricing normalization. In practice this has added a real cost bump to new systems — we're seeing $300-$800 more per system compared to equivalent R-410A units from two years ago, and that gap is narrowing but hasn't disappeared.
Second, Title 24 2022 code cycle (still in effect through this code cycle) tightened duct sealing and testing requirements on replacements, which is good for your energy bill but adds the HERS testing cost mentioned above if it wasn't already required in your last permit history.
Third, and this one's boring but real: copper, steel cabinet material, and skilled labor costs have all crept up. A NATE-certified technician who actually knows how to commission a variable-speed system correctly isn't cheap to employ, and that cost shows up in your invoice whether you notice it or not.
Heat Pump or Straight AC? The Comparison Nobody Explains Clearly
A standard AC-plus-gas-furnace setup is still the most common thing we install in LA, and for good reason — it's a known quantity, parts are everywhere, and if your furnace is under 12 years old, replacing just the AC side often makes financial sense. Expect the AC-only portion to run in the ranges above, with your existing furnace staying in place assuming it's compatible with the new coil.
A heat pump system replaces both your AC and your gas furnace with one piece of equipment that heats and cools. In LA's climate — mild winters, brutal but short summer heat — heat pumps make a lot of sense, and utilities including SCE have been pushing rebates for exactly this reason. Installed cost runs $9,500-$16,000 for a ducted heat pump system depending on tonnage and tier, which sounds like more than a straight AC swap, but you're also retiring a gas furnace and potentially qualifying for $1,000-$3,000 in utility or state incentives depending on what's active when you sign. If your furnace is already near end of life (15+ years, cracked heat exchanger risk, or it's been short-cycling), a heat pump conversion often costs less over five years than replacing the AC now and the furnace in three years separately.
The honest tradeoff: heat pumps cost more upfront and require an electrician to confirm your panel can handle the load — a lot of homes in Valley Village and Encino built in the 1950s-60s have 100-amp panels that are already maxed out with EV chargers and pool equipment, and that's a $2,500-$4,500 panel upgrade if it's needed. We tell people straight: if your panel's tight, get that assessed before you fall in love with a heat pump quote.
The Failure Modes That Actually Push People to Replace
We see this every week in North Hollywood and Sherman Oaks — the same handful of failures show up over and over, and they're worth knowing so you're not surprised.
Compressor failure
The compressor is the heart of the system and the most expensive single part. On a system past 10-12 years old, a compressor replacement quote often lands within a couple thousand dollars of just replacing the whole outdoor unit — and since the compressor failed once already, the coil and other components are usually close behind. This is the single biggest reason repair-vs-replace conversations end in replacement.
Evaporator coil leaks from formicary corrosion
LA's coastal-influenced air combined with certain older copper coil formulations causes pinhole leaks over time — it's a slow, hard-to-find leak, not a dramatic blowout. If you've had your system "topped off" with refrigerant more than once in three years, this is almost always what's happening, and it means the coil, not just the charge, needs replacing.
Undersized or leaky ductwork causing short cycling
A brand new high-efficiency condenser paired with ductwork that was sized for a 1968 system will short-cycle, run loud, and never actually deliver the SEER rating printed on the box. This is the single most common reason a "new AC still doesn't cool the back bedrooms" call comes in.
R-22 systems still running
Production and import of R-22 ended years ago, and reclaimed refrigerant now costs more per pound than most homeowners expect. If your system still uses R-22 and needs a recharge, that alone often costs more than a month's mortgage payment, and it's the clearest signal it's time to replace rather than repair.
Permitting in LA: What Happens If You Skip It
Every legitimate AC replacement in the City of Los Angeles requires an LADBS mechanical permit, and if ductwork in an attic is involved, a Title 24 HERS duct leakage test before final sign-off. We know some contractors quote "cash price, no permit" to undercut competitors, and we understand the appeal when you're trying to save a few hundred dollars. But an unpermitted HVAC system is a documented problem at resale — LA-area home inspectors flag it routinely, and title companies increasingly ask for permit history on any HVAC work done in the last 10 years. It can also void manufacturer warranty coverage since most manufacturers require proof of licensed, code-compliant installation. The permit fee is small compared to what an unpermitted system costs you when you go to sell.
Checklist: What to Ask Before You Sign Any AC Proposal
- Is the tonnage based on an actual Manual J load calculation, or just "what was there before"?
- Does the quote include a mechanical permit and Title 24 HERS duct testing if ductwork is in the attic?
- Is the equipment R-454B compatible and properly listed for that refrigerant, or is it old-stock R-410A being cleared out?
- What SEER2 rating is actually being installed, and does it match what's on the proposal in writing?
- Is ductwork being inspected, and if replacement is recommended, why — leaks, undersizing, or asbestos-era material?
- What's the labor warranty — one year, five years, or a true 10-year labor warranty backing the installation itself?
- Will the crew pull a proper vacuum (500 microns) and verify charge by weight and superheat/subcooling, not just gauge feel?
- Is the contractor a licensed C-20 in California, and can they provide the license number on request?

Financing and Rebates Worth Checking Before You Commit
Depending on what's active when you're reading this, SCE and SoCalGas both run seasonal rebate programs for higher-efficiency equipment and heat pump conversions, sometimes stacking $500-$2,000 in incentives. There's also the federal Energy Efficient Home Improvement Credit, which can cover a percentage of qualifying high-efficiency equipment costs up to certain caps — worth checking with your tax preparer since eligibility depends on SEER2 and HSPF2 ratings, not just brand name. Financing through 0%-interest promotional periods is common for 12-18 months, and for a $10,000-$15,000 system that can make a real difference in cash flow without adding real cost if you pay it off in the window.
